Raleigh, North Carolina is a great place to find full-time employment for those seeking a career in the area. The city is home to major employers such as IBM, SAS Institute, Red Hat, and WakeMed Health & Hospitals, making it an ideal location for those looking to jumpstart their career. Additionally, Raleigh is the state capital, so there are plenty of government job opportunities available. With the city’s low unemployment rate and diverse job market, it’s no wonder why so many people are choosing to work in Raleigh. Raleigh is home to a number of industries, including technology, healthcare, finance, education, and government. Technology jobs are plentiful in Raleigh due to the presence of major companies such as IBM, SAS Institute, and Red Hat. For those looking to work in healthcare, WakeMed Health & Hospitals is a great option. The city is also home to numerous financial institutions and banks, providing plenty of job opportunities for those interested in finance. Meanwhile, the city’s university system provides a range of employment opportunities for those interested in the education field. Finally, the city’s government sector offers a range of jobs, including those in public safety and public administration. Overall, Raleigh is an ideal place to find a full-time job. The city’s diverse job market, low unemployment rate, and abundance of major employers make it an ideal location for those seeking a career in the area. With its wide array of industries, Raleigh has something for everyone. Whether you’re looking for a job in technology, healthcare, finance, education, or government, Raleigh is home to a number of employers that can provide full-time employment. Jira is one of the most popular project management tools available on the market today. It is widely used by software development teams to plan, track, and manage their projects. Perforce, on the other hand, is a popular version control system that is used by many software development teams to manage the codebase of their projects. Jira and Perforce are two powerful tools that can be integrated to streamline the software development process. One of the key features of this integration is the ability to create Perforce jobs directly from Jira. In this article, we will explore the Jira create Perforce job function in detail and discuss its benefits. What is a Perforce Job? Before we dive into the Jira create Perforce job function, let's first understand what a Perforce job is. A Perforce job is a record that is used to track and manage issues, enhancements, and bugs in a software development project. It is a way to capture and organize all the issues that need to be addressed in a project. Perforce jobs are typically created by developers or testers who encounter issues while working on a project. A job can be assigned to a specific developer or team, and it can be tracked through its lifecycle until it is resolved. Perforce jobs can be linked to source code changes, allowing developers to see which changes were made to fix a particular issue. This makes it easier to understand the history of a project and to track down the root cause of any issues that arise. What is the Jira create Perforce job function? The Jira create Perforce job function allows developers to create Perforce jobs directly from Jira. This means that developers can create a new job in Perforce without leaving the Jira interface. To use this function, developers need to have the Jira Perforce integration set up. Once this is done, they can create a new Perforce job by following these steps: 1. Open the Jira issue that needs to be tracked in Perforce. 2. Click on the "Create Perforce Job" button in the Jira interface. 3. Fill in the necessary details for the Perforce job, such as the job description, severity, and priority. 4. Click "Create" to create the new Perforce job. Once the job is created, it will be linked to the Jira issue, allowing developers to track the job's progress directly from Jira. What are the benefits of the Jira create Perforce job function? Rejection is a part of life, and it is a part of the hiring process. As a hiring manager or recruiter, it is essential to be able to craft a well-written job rejection letter. A job rejection letter needs to be professional, polite, and empathetic. It should convey the message that while the candidate was not selected for the position, their application was appreciated and their efforts were acknowledged. In this article, we will discuss the importance of a job rejection letter, the components of a good job rejection letter, and tips on how to write a nice job rejection letter that leaves a positive impression on the candidate. Importance of a job rejection letter A job rejection letter is not just a formality; it is an essential part of the hiring process. It is the final communication between the company and the candidate, and it can leave a lasting impression on the candidate. A well-written job rejection letter can help to maintain a positive relationship with the candidate, even though they were not selected for the role. Moreover, a job rejection letter provides closure for the candidate. It acknowledges their efforts and lets them know that their application was considered. It also helps to prevent any uncertainty or confusion about the status of their application. Components of a good job rejection letter 1. Thank the candidate for their application The first component of a good job rejection letter is to thank the candidate for their application. This shows that the company values the candidate's time and effort in applying for the role. It also sets a positive tone for the rest of the letter. 2. Provide a clear and concise explanation The second component of a good job rejection letter is to provide a clear and concise explanation of why the candidate was not selected for the role. This can include reasons such as lack of experience or qualifications, a better-suited candidate was selected, or the role was no longer available. It is important to be honest with the candidate and provide specific feedback where possible. However, it is equally important to avoid giving false hope or making promises that cannot be kept. 3. Express empathy The third component of a good job rejection letter is to express empathy. Receiving a job rejection letter can be a disappointing experience, and it is important to acknowledge the candidate's feelings. Expressing empathy can help to soften the blow and maintain a positive relationship with the candidate. 4. Offer encouragement The fourth component of a good job rejection letter is to offer encouragement. This can include encouraging the candidate to apply for other roles within the company, suggesting other companies or opportunities that may be a better fit for their skills and experience, or providing feedback on how they can improve their application for future roles. Tips on how to write a nice job rejection letter 1. Be prompt One of the most important tips for writing a nice job rejection letter is to be prompt. Candidates appreciate timely feedback, and it shows that the company values their time and effort. Ideally, a job rejection letter should be sent within a week of the candidate's application. 2. Personalize the letter Another important tip for writing a nice job rejection letter is to personalize the letter. Address the candidate by name and reference specific elements of their application. This shows that the company took the time to review their application and that they were considered for the role. 3. Keep it professional It is important to keep the job rejection letter professional. Avoid using overly casual language or including unnecessary details. Stick to the facts and keep the tone polite and respectful. 4. Provide constructive feedback Another tip for writing a nice job rejection letter is to provide constructive feedback where possible. This can include suggestions on how the candidate can improve their application for future roles or areas for development that they can focus on. 5. Offer to stay in touch Finally, it can be helpful to offer to stay in touch with the candidate. This can include inviting them to connect on LinkedIn, offering to answer any questions they may have about the hiring process or the company, or encouraging them to apply for future roles within the company. In conclusion, writing a nice job rejection letter is an important part of the hiring process. It can help to maintain a positive relationship with the candidate, provide closure, and offer constructive feedback. By following the tips outlined in this article, hiring managers and recruiters can craft well-written job rejection letters that leave a positive impression on candidates.
